Buyer’s Guide

Choosing the right cable cover can help protect your cords from damage and keep your workspace organized. With so many options available, it’s essential to consider the right features and factors before making your purchase. Here’s a buyer’s guide to help you make the right decision.

Important Features to Consider

When shopping for cable covers, there are several features you should consider, such as the following:

  1. Size and thickness: Measure the diameter of the cables you intend to cover and choose a cover with the appropriate size and thickness. 2. Material: Look for materials like plastic, rubber, or metal that can withstand wear and tear while providing adequate protection. 3. Durability: Ensure the cable cover can withstand accidental impacts or rough handling in a busy workspace. 4. Installation: Some cable covers require tools for installation, while others are easy to install without any tools. Look for a cover that fits your skill level and workspace.

Special Considerations

In addition to the features mentioned earlier, consider the following factors when choosing a cable cover:

  1. Workplace environment: Consider the kind of environment where the cable cover will be used. For example, if it’s a construction site with heavy machinery, you may need a more robust cover. 2. Cable type: The type of cable you’ll be covering may affect the features you need. For example, if you need to protect delicate components, you may need a more padded cover. 3. Aesthetic: While it may not be the most critical factor, it’s worth considering the look of the cable cover, especially if it’s in a public workspace or visible area.

General Advice

To get the most out of your cable cover, here are some general tips to follow:

  1. Read the instructions carefully: Make sure you foll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for installation to avoid any issues. 2. Choose the right cover for the job: Not all cable covers are created equal, so choose the one that’s designed for your specific needs. 3. Inspect the cable cover regularly: Regularly examine the cable cover to ensure it’s still in good condition and providing adequate protection.

FAQ

What is a cable cover?

A cable cover is a protective covering designed to conceal and protect electrical cables from damage. It is typically made of a durable material, such as plastic or metal, and is available in various sizes to accommodate different cable arrangements. Cable covers offer a clean and tidy appearance to the space where the cables are located, making them a popular choice for home and office environments.

By protecting cables from accidental damage or wear and tear, cable covers can extend the lifespan of the cables and improve the overall safety of the electrical system. Additionally, they can be used to prevent cables from being tripped over or damaged by foot traffic or moving equipment, reducing the risk of injury or equipment damage.

How do I choose the right cable cover for my needs?

There are several factors to consider when selecting a cable cover. First, consider the size and shape of the cable bundle that needs to be covered. Many cable covers are available in standard sizes, but custom sizes can also be ordered to ensure a proper fit. Make sure that the cover can accommodate the number of cables and their overall thickness.

Another important consideration is the type of environment in which the cable cover will be used. For outdoor applications, choose a cover made from weather-resistant materials that can withstand exposure to the elements. In environments with high foot traffic or heavy equipment use, a more durable and protective cover may be necessary. Finally, consider the desired appearance and color of the cable cover. Many covers are available in a variety of colors and finishes to match the surrounding decor.

What materials are cable covers typically made of, and which ones are the most durable?

Cable covers are typically made from materials such as plastic, rubber, or metal. Plastic and rubber covers are lightweight and easy to install, but they may be more susceptible to wear and tear over time. Metal covers, on the other hand, are more durable and can withstand heavy use, making them a popular choice for high-traffic areas or industrial settings.

For maximum durability, look for cable covers made from materials such as aluminum or stainless steel. These materials are corrosion-resistant and can withstand exposure to harsh environments. However, they may also be more expensive than plastic or rubber covers. Consider the specific needs of your application to determine the best material for your cable cover.
